Subpanel Installation in Prescott Valley, AZ

Subpanel installation services involve adding a secondary electrical panel to a property to support increased power needs or to better organize electrical circuits. This service is often requested for home renovations, additions, or when upgrading electrical systems to accommodate new appliances, HVAC systems, or other high-demand equipment. Property owners typically want to understand how a subpanel can improve electrical distribution, reduce overload risks, and enhance safety by providing a dedicated space for circuit management.

Before requesting a subpanel installation, homeowners should consider the current electrical capacity of their main panel and whether it can support additional circuits. It's also important to evaluate the location where the subpanel will be installed, ensuring proper access and compliance with local electrical codes. Understanding the scope of the project, including the number of circuits needed and any potential upgrades to the main panel, helps property owners plan effectively and ensures the installation meets their specific electrical demands.

Subpanel Installation Questions

What is a subpanel? A subpanel is an additional electrical panel that extends power to specific areas of a property, providing more circuit capacity and organization.

Why install a subpanel? Installing a subpanel helps manage electrical loads more effectively and can simplify wiring for additions or renovations.

Where should a subpanel be located? A subpanel is typically placed in accessible areas like garages, basements, or utility rooms for convenience and safety.

What types of projects often require a subpanel? Subpanels are commonly used for home additions, garage wiring, workshop setups, or upgrading electrical systems to support new appliances.
